Connect your research platform directly to Claude
Great Question's Model Context Protocol server gives Claude direct access to your research data: studies, participants, insights, and your entire repository. No more copy-pasting between tools.
- Query your research repository from Claude: “What did customers say about onboarding in Q4?”
- Pull participant data and study results into AI analysis workflows.
- Automate insight tagging, highlight extraction, and cross-study synthesis.
- Works with Claude Desktop, Claude Code, and any MCP-compatible client.
Run this command in Claude Code to add Great Question as an MCP server.
claude mcp add --transport http great-question \ https://greatquestion.co/api/mcp/v1

JTBD analyzer
Reads transcripts (or notes) and produces a structured JTBD analysis. It writes a core job statement in Moesta's “when… I want to… so I can…” format, maps push/pull/anxiety/habit forces with evidence and quotes from the transcript.
Research brief writer
Generates research briefs from a business question. Recommends methodology, defines success criteria, estimates timeline, and scopes participant requirements.
JTBD interview guide builder
Generates a complete JTBD moderation guide based on the Competing Against Luck methodology. It builds out the six-stage timeline walkthrough with opening questions and 3 to 4 probes per stage, includes a four forces deep-dive section (push, pull, anxiety, habits).
Survey designer
Builds a research-quality survey from a clearly stated goal. It structures the survey with a context-setter, behavioral anchors, core questions, and an open-ended closer. It picks response formats that actually match the research question (frequency scales for behaviors, Likert for opinions, NPS for advocacy, max-diff for ranking).

Prompt library Copy-paste prompts for every research stage
Tested on real research projects. Each prompt includes context-setting, specific instructions, and output formatting so Claude knows exactly what you need.
Planning
Works for generative, evaluative, and mixed-method studies.
I'm planning a [method] study about [topic]. My research questions are [X]. Generate a research brief with methodology justification, participant criteria, timeline, and risk factors.
Recruiting
Pairs with the Screener Builder skill for automated workflows.
Create a screener survey for [target persona]. Include 8-10 questions that filter for [criteria]. Flag red-flag responses that indicate poor fit. Output as a table I can paste into Great Question.
Analysis
Best with 5-15 transcripts; use the Synthesizer skill for 15+.
Here are transcripts from [N] interviews about [topic]. Identify the top themes with supporting quotes, note contradictions between participants, and flag surprising findings I should investigate further.
Synthesis
Cross-study synthesis: one of AI's strongest research applications.
Compare findings from these [N] studies conducted over [time period]. What patterns are consistent? What's shifted? Generate a longitudinal insight map with confidence levels.
Stakeholder communication
Customize framing for PMs, designers, or leadership audiences.
Turn these research findings into a 1-page executive summary for [audience]. Lead with the 3 most actionable insights, include supporting evidence, and end with recommended next steps.
Repository
Builds on the Insight Tagger skill for ongoing repo management.
Review these [N] research highlights and generate a consistent tagging taxonomy. Map each highlight to themes, assign sentiment, and identify which insights connect across multiple studies.
